### Runbook: BounceBroom — Account Recovery

If the BounceBroom email bounce processor loses access to its service account, do not create a new one. First, pause the intake queue so bounces buffer safely. Then open the recovery console and select the BounceBroom principal. Verification requires approval from the on-call lead. Once approved, the console prompts for the stored recovery credentials; enter the passphrase that appears directly below this paragraph.

recovery phrase for fahof-kahap: holion-gormir-jorix-istix-briwyn-sorael

The twelve-week pilot placing our Lintra home-goods line in fourteen Norvale Stores locations concluded last month. Gross margin landed at 31%, two points under target, mainly due to expedited freight during the launch window. Sell-through exceeded forecast in urban branches and lagged in the Dunmere region. Norvale has signalled interest in a wider rollout, contingent on revised logistics terms. Finance should prepare scenario models for 40- and 80-store expansions by month-end. The broader plan this feeds into is outlined below.

confidential, tajop-fafop: Headcount on the Oliwyn team goes from 18 to 114 by the end of June. Gross margin on Oliwyn came in at 47 percent against a plan of 36 percent.

The sale of the Ferrowline Components unit to Aldermist Group has cleared internal review. Completion is targeted for end of Q3. Staff communications are embargoed until the signing date. Department heads must freeze non-essential hiring within Ferrowline immediately and route all transition queries through the divestiture office. No external statements of any kind. Payroll and systems separation plans will circulate next week. Read the appended note before briefing your teams; it follows directly below.

management briefing: Project Ulavan slips by two quarters because of the staffing delay.